概括
与Cas12a相比,CRISPR/Cas14a在单核酸多态 (SNP) 检测方面表现出更高的准确性. 将CRISPR/Cas14a与阻断器位移放大 (BDA) 结合起来,可以非常灵敏地识别与癌症相关的BRAF突变.

背景情况:
- 单核酸多态 (SNP) 是癌症诊断中的关键生物标志物.
- 克里斯普尔系统为遗传分析提供可编程和准确的工具.
- 现有的SNP检测方法在灵敏度和特异性方面面临挑战.
研究的目的:
- 为了比较两种类型VCRISPR/Cas系统 (Cas12a和Cas14a) 在癌症相关SNP检测方面的有效性.
- 通过使用CRISPR技术提高SNP识别的准确性.
- 开发一种敏感的方法来检测特定的癌症突变.
主要方法:
- 用BRAF基因对SNP不匹配耐受性进行CRISPR/Cas12a和CRISPR/Cas14a系统的比较分析.
- 阻断器位移放大 (BDA) 与CRISPR/Cas14a系统的整合
- 应用BDA辅助的CRISPR/Cas14a系统来检测结直肠癌细胞中的BRAF突变.
主要成果:
- 在SNP检测方面,CRISPR/Cas14a显示出比CRISPR/Cas12a更高的准确性和稳定性.
- 在BDA-CRISPR/Cas14a系统检测到BRAF V600E在10^3副本与0.1%的变异性等位基因频率.
- 该系统在结直肠癌细胞中识别了BRAF突变,具有0.5%的变异性等位基因频率灵敏度.
结论:
- 与CRISPR/Cas12a相比,CRISPR/Cas14a是SNP检测的一个优越平台.
- 由BDA辅助的CRISPR/Cas14a系统为癌症突变检测提供了高度敏感和准确的方法.
- 这种方法为精准医学和癌症诊断提供了有前途的工具.

Bacteria and archaea are susceptible to viral infections just like eukaryotes; therefore, they have developed a unique adaptive immune system to protect themselves. Clustered regularly interspaced short palindromic repeats and CRISPR-associated proteins (CRISPR-Cas) are present in more than 45% of known bacteria and 90% of known archaea.

Genome editing technologies allow scientists to modify an organism’s DNA via the addition, removal, or rearrangement of genetic material at specific genomic locations. These types of techniques could potentially be used to cure genetic disorders such as hemophilia and sickle cell anemia. One popular and widely used DNA-editing research tool that could lead to safe and effective cures for genetic disorders is the CRISPR-Cas9 system. The basic reaction of homologous recombination (HR) involves two chromatids that contain DNA sequences sharing a significant stretch of identity. One of these sequences uses a strand from another as a template to synthesize DNA in an enzyme-catalyzed reaction. The final product is a novel amalgamation of the two substrates.
